Post All The Free Upgrades! 
 
Yesterday while going through the PTP list to clean out dead sites I noticed a ton of sites offering free upgrades to X amount of members till X amount. I wonder really if the Free upgrades are beneficial to the site or to the members.

If a site for example is giving away 1000 free upgrades that is advertising from at least a big group of members monthly to send out. Since i am not a member of these sites I am curious if the member really is getting anything for Free? Are the clicks really worth it you might get for your ads.

For the site whether the ads or points or banners the PO has to pay for that somewhere. Whether it be in point conversions, redemptions, time, bandwith or other.

I am not sure how offering a 1000 free upgrades is beneficial to the site. Besides the fact those who join just for the advertising but do not bother to participate in the site. I am not saying all do but I would assume a large majority do. So this alone would lower overall ctr rates.

Then of course we have the other question which I am not sure fits in with this but are these sites banking on only PTP advertising?

PTR right now is in a downward spiral. There are a few sites trying to be something more but it seems the majority have the attitude why try to do something innovative ride the ride as long as you can till you can't go any further. I think it would make more sense to focus on what one could do in the long run and make sure they are still here then looking at short term goals.

Anways any opinions of the good and the bad of sites which offer Free upgrades? Are they beneficial to the site or the member?

I really don't see a benefit to the free upgrades as far as being a member.  The ads are mostly lower value ads no one wants to click on from what I've experienced.  I think it is just a way to attract members and hope to get a few good ones from it.  On most of the sites which offer the free upgrade you have to maintain a certain level of activity or lose the upgrade and on some you have to be a member for 30 days and then request the upgrade.  
I kind of compare it to what I've heard referred to as loss leaders in the retail business, give away something in hopes that they'll buy something while they're here to get the freebie and it will offset the cost.

I tried one of these type deals a while back. I didn't think it was as good a deal as they try to make it out as. I got an extra ref level, but low an behold so did every other member who joined. That didn't help the blind join rotation. I got a few banner impressions monthly. The banner got put out there but the actual click thru was nil. I don't honestly feel that it helped as the site still is under the 500 member limit they were allowing for the free upgrade. To me it was actually a waste of my time and energy, but since it was the newest, lastest craze at the time, I had to try it out to see what the fuss was all about.
